Medical Malpractice Lawyers

Medical professionals are legally bound to follow certain standards when treating patients. If your accident or death resulted from a breach of this obligation and you are a victim, you may be entitled to compensation.

The first step is establishing that the doctor or hospital who treated you had an obligation under the law. This requires you to review your medical records as well as any other documentation.

Duty of care

The English common law forms the foundation of current medical malpractice laws. It is a legal system that was developed through the decisions of judges and the courts rather than through executive orders or legislative statutes.

To be successful in a claim for malpractice the lawyer representing the plaintiff must establish that the doctor or hospital was bound by an obligation of care for the person injured. This duty includes the obligation to adhere to accepted medical standards. This duty also includes the obligation to inform patients of known risks that are associated with a procedure or treatment. A doctor's duty of care is violated when they fail to do this.

Breaches of the duty of care are commonplace in medical malpractice cases. The injury or damage must be directly caused by the breach. A surgeon, for example who does not perform additional tests on the basis of symptoms may be liable.

A patient can prove that a physician or health professional has violated their duty of care by giving an expert testimony. Such experts have the same qualifications, training and expertise as the alleged medical professional.

In addition to expert testimony, a plaintiff's attorney must provide evidence of damages. This can include medical records, Xrays, and laboratory reports. An attorney for medical malpractice may also engage an outside examiner to evaluate the plaintiffs injuries. These examinations can give an accurate assessment of the extent of the injuries and help to strengthen the plaintiff's case.

Breach of duty

You may be entitled compensation in the event that a medical professional violates a legal obligation owed to you, as patient, and the breach causes you to suffer an injury or ailment. The key is to prove that the physician was negligent, but this can be difficult to do.

Common law is the legal system that governs medical malpractice claims. This is an unwritten system of law that was established by the rulings of judges and courts and not legislative statutes. Each state has its own laws that govern what constitutes medical malpractice. Your lawyer can clarify the laws of your state.

In New York, the law requires doctors to adhere to an extremely high standard of care when treating patients. This standard is defined as the care that reasonable and prudent healthcare provider would offer under similar circumstances. To prove negligence, your attorney must first show that the doctor did not uphold the standard of care and the failure caused you harm.

A breach of the standards of care could take a variety of forms. A surgeon could accidentally cut off the wrong area of your limb, leaving you with restricted movement or requiring additional surgeries to restore function. Your lawyer must also prove that the surgeon's actions or omissions directly caused your injuries or health problems. This is known as proving causation.

Causation

In medical malpractice cases, the plaintiff must prove all elements of negligence, including duty, breach, causation and harm. Typically, this requires the plaintiff to provide expert testimony that demonstrates that the medical malpractice lawsuit professional's actions or inactions departed from the norm of care and resulted in harm. The defense could then question the expert testimony of the plaintiff and contest their findings.

A healthcare provider or doctor provider may also resort to various defenses to try and stay out of liability for medical malpractice. Damages

Medical negligence occurs when a person is unable to provide adequate care to the patient, resulting in injury or worsens the condition. It can include failing to recognize a disease or injury surgical errors, a failure to diagnose a disease, and more. In some states, patients who suffered from medical malpractice may make claims for damages to seek compensation.

To prevail in a malpractice lawsuit, you must establish four legal elements: a professional obligation owed to you; breach of that duty; causation and medical malpractice law firms injury and damages. Your lawyer will spend time going through the vast medical records and conducting interviews on the record with you, the medical professionals who treated you, as well as experts in your case.

Economic awards compensate you for your financial losses, such as the costs of any additional corrective treatment as well as lost income. Your New York medical malpractice lawyer can assist you in determining the proper amount. Non-economic awards, such as pain and suffer are more subjective. Your attorney and you must prove that the doctor made a mistake that affected your quality of living.
